Step 1
Cut chicken into roughly 1-inch pieces.
Step 2
Preheat the oven to about 325 degrees Fahrenheit. Coat a 9 x 13 baking dish with nonstick cooking spray or lightly oil it.
Step 3
Combine ketchup, garlic powder, sugar, vinegar, and soy sauce in a bowl; place aside.
Step 4
Season chicken with pepper and salt. Add cornstarch and toss lightly to coat. Dip each chicken piece into the eggs one at a time.
Step 5
In a big saucepan, heat the vegetable oil. Cook the chicken for 1-2 minutes, or until golden brown. Take out to a dish lined with kitchen paper towels to drain any extra oil.
Step 6
Transfer the chicken to the prepared baking pan. Toss with prepared sauce mixture—Bake for around 50 minutes, or until the sauce thickens. Turn the chicken over after 15 minutes to ensure equal cooking.
Step 7
Garnish with green onion for added flavor and color. Serve immediately and enjoy!
